Weekend Planner: Food Truck Thowdown, Yoga Brunch and More

Ashmont Grill patio
Don’t forget to check out the Food Truck Throwdown Saturday, when Boston’s top food trucks compete against those of New York City on the Rose Kennedy Greenway (11 AM-9 PM; click here for details). And if you’re in the South End, stop by Stir, Barbara Lynch’s cooking studio and bookstore for an early pre-holiday sale and baked goods (617-423-7847).

On Sunday, it’s the last chance for yoga on the Ashmont Grill patio. Class starts at 9:30 AM followed by brunch ($25 per person; 617-825-4300).

Moving into Monday, on October 15 check out Tremont 647’s Caribbean-themed dinner that features tropical dishes like spit-roasted jerk chicken, conch fritters and more, served family style with rum drinks (6 PM; $29 per person for tickets; 617-266-4600). You can also learn some new moves in the kitchen. Enroll in a class with Harvest chef Mary Dumont, who will teach you how to whip up some hearty fare paired with beer at the Boston Center for Adult Education (6 PM; $70 per person plus $15 for class materials; 617-267-4430 or click her to sign up).
